Description | This intricate spell instantly erects a time shield around the caster, preventing any incoming damage and sending it forward in time.
Once either the maximum damage of (50 + [50]450cTSpD) is absorbed, or the duration of (5 + Talent Level) turns expires, the stored damage will return as a temporal restoration field over 5 turns. Each turn the restoration field is active, you get healed for 10% of the absorbed damage (the Shielding talent affects the percentage). While under the effect of Time Shield, all newly applied magical, physical and mental effects will have their durations reduced by (25 + 2 * Talent Level)%, up to a maximum of 35%. The shield's max absorption will increase with your Spellpower. |
